All eyes on CM as Centre doesn't meet Mhadei deadline
The 15-day deadline set by the State to get justice on Mhadei issue ended on Thursday, with no response coming forth from the Union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change.
MoEF&CC Minister Prakash Javdekar during his meeting in Goa with Chief Minister Pramod Sawant, had sought 15 days to come out with a decision on the Mhadei imbroglio.
Post the meeting, Sawant had threatened to move the NGT against the Ministry if it failed to withdraw within a fortnight.
Sawant had also said that he would support protesters and political parties on the issue if the Centre does not withdraw the October 17 letter.
